Templates

The templates directory contains a theme’s template files, which control what’s rendered on each type of page.

Blog overview

Used to build a blog index page, displaying all posts.

The blog overview template consists of an index.html and an index.css file.

Blog posts are passed via a posts array of Post objects.

The blog overview page automatically implements pagination, displaying 12 posts per page. A Pagination object can be accessed via paginate in the index.html code to generate links to other pages, display page counts etc.

The blog overview page is automatically generated at site.com/blog.

Blog post

Displays a single blog post.

The blog post template consists of an index.html and an index.css file.

The blog post is passed via a single post Post object.

Each blog post is automatically generated at site.com/blog/post-slug.

Content

Displays a single content biography.

The content template consists of an index.html file.

The content biography is passed via a single content Content object.

Each content page is automatically generated at site.com/contents/content-slug.

Product

Displays a single product.

The product template consists of an index.html and an index.css file.

The product is passed via a single product Product object.

Each product page is automatically generated at site.com/products/product-slug. If the product is part of a series, the product page will also be available at site.com/products/*series-slug*/*product-departure-date*.

Product templates can include a schema in order to define the variables a Creator can use to customise the template.

Selections

Optional

Selections is a way for a customer to come back after booking and make selections on their order, e.g. which workshops they’ll attend.

The selections template consists of an index.html file.

The selection is passed via a single item Modifier Selection object. It combines the data for a particular line item with the guest information for the customer currently logged in.

Each selection page is automatically generated at site.com/items/*booking-id*/selections and can only be accessed by the customer to whose booking the selection applies.

Recommendation

Optional

The template is passed via a single recommendation Recommendation object.

The recommendation page is automatically generated at site.com/recommendations/recommendation_slug when a valid recommendation has been created.

This template will only render if it has been configured on the associated site - otherwise, the default recommendation page will be rendered.

Package booking

Optional

Packages allow creators to build their own custom multi-step booking journeys.

Each step will expose a number of creator-selected variants that the customer may choose from to complete their package booking.

On each step of the journey, the customer adds one of the available options and moves on to the next step.

Behind the scenes, the platform is “orchestrating” the booking journey by linking them from step URL to step URL until checkout, and steps are rendered using the Package Booking template.

The details of the current step (name, description, available variants, URL of the next page) are exposed to the template via the package_step Package Step object.

Package booking templates can include a schema in order to define the variables a Creator can use to customise the template.
